Page 2: Group Study Exchange RY 2011 - 12

Your Foundation Dollars In ActionA Vocation/Cultural Exchange

With Districts in Other Countries

All Expense Paid4 – 6 Week ExchangeHome Stay ProgramRotarian Team Leader4 – 5 Non-Rotarian Team

MembersFrom Any VocationFrom 25 – 40 Years OldU. S. CitizensNot Directly Related to a

Rotarian

Page 3: Group Study Exchange RY 2011 - 12

GSE Program Objectives Observe vocation abroad Develop professional and

leadership skills Understand challenges of

the global workplace Learn about a new culture

and/or language Serve communities in

which we live Network with business

leaders and host families Foster lifelong association

between Rotary and alumni Attract people to Rotary

who are unfamiliar with our organization

Page 4: Group Study Exchange RY 2011 - 12

What Team Members Do In The Host Country

• Exhaust Themselves• Make Presentations to Rotary Clubs & Civic Groups• Visit Historical Sights and Points of Interest• Attend Host District’s Annual Conference• Spend Several Vocational Days With Professionals from Your Field • Meet Numerous Leaders and Politicos• Work on Some Local Club Projects• Make Radio, Television, or Public Appearances• Engage Excessively in the Five Way Test
